£1/2million lotto ticket unclaimed in Wirral



A LUCKY lottery ticket owner from Wirral could have half a million pounds in his or her back pocket.
An amazing EuroMillions prize of £425,575 has yet to be claimed, so National Lottery players in Wirral are being urged to check and double-check their tickets for the chance to claim this life-changing prize in time.

The winning ticket, bought in the Wirral, who matched the five main numbers and one Lucky Star in the EuroMillions draw on Friday 5 November, Bonfire Night.

The winning EuroMillions numbers on that date were 21, 23, 33, 40, 50 and the Lucky Stars were 4 and 5. The lucky ticket-holder has until 5.30pm on May 4, 2011 to claim.
A National Lottery spokesperson said: “We’re desperate to find this mystery ticket-holder and unite them with their winnings.”

Anyone who believes they have this or any other winning ticket should call 0845 910 0000.
